Minister of State for Power and Heavy Industries, Shri Krishan Pal inaugurated UTPRERAK – India’s Centre of Excellence for Energy Efficiency Technologies at NPTI, Badarpur, New Delhi on June 26, 2023.

UTPRERAK is expected to train more than 10,000 energy professionals over the next 5 years.

It will also provide key inputs for national energy policy formulation and link education and research in energy-efficient solutions.
